Summary Review: Neverwinter for PlayStation 4

Once a bustling location, Neverwinter now stands as a testament to the tragedies it has endured over the years. As a seasoned retro gaming enthusiast, I couldn’t help but be intrigued by the promise of a game that blends vintage charm with modern gameplay. However, despite its potential, Neverwinter fails to capture the magic of classic games, leaving me somewhat disappointed with my experience.

From a technical standpoint, Neverwinter on PlayStation 4 leaves much to be desired. The controls feel clunky and unresponsive, lacking the precision that is so crucial for a game of this nature. Moreover, the frame rate drops and occasional glitches detract from the overall immersion. For someone seeking a nostalgic experience reminiscent of classic titles, these technical flaws serve as a reminder of the importance of polishing a game to perfection.

Storytelling has always been a vital element of retro gaming, captivating players with rich narratives that stand the test of time. However, Neverwinter falls short in this aspect. While the premise of factions battling for dominance in a city ravaged by disaster holds promise, the execution falls flat. The story lacks depth, leaving players craving for a more immersive and engaging plot. As an experienced retro gaming journalist, I appreciate the importance of a well-crafted narrative that keeps players invested and yearning for more, and sadly, Neverwinter falls short in this regard.

On a positive note, Neverwinter does manage to evoke a sense of nostalgia through its visual design. The city of Neverwinter, with its crumbling architecture and desolate streets, successfully captures the feeling of a once-thriving location now in ruins. This visual representation pays homage to the classic games of the past, reminding players of the hauntingly beautiful environments that defined the retro gaming era.

Furthermore, the character customization options in Neverwinter provide a touch of nostalgia, allowing players to create unique avatars that harken back to the days of pixelated heroes. The ability to customize and personalize one’s character is a classic feature that adds an element of individuality and creativity to the gaming experience, and it is a welcome addition to Neverwinter.

In conclusion, Neverwinter for PlayStation 4 may not meet the expectations of seasoned retro gaming enthusiasts seeking a truly immersive and nostalgic experience. While it manages to capture elements of classic games through its visual design and character customization, its technical flaws and lackluster storytelling prevent it from truly shining. With a little more polish and attention to detail, Neverwinter could have been a true gem for retro gaming enthusiasts, but for now, it falls short of its potential.
